Courtland Gardens Nursing & Rehabilitation Center, formerly Jewish Convalescent & Nursing Home, is a Joint Commission accredited center. The Joint Commission evaluates and sanctions health care organizations and programs across the United States. This independent, not-for-profit organization is the predominant standards-setting body for health care in the nation.

Courtland Gardens is a LifeBridge Health center, a constituent agency of THE ASSOCIATED: Jewish Community Federation of Baltimore.
Other affiliations include membership in:
The American Association of Homes for the Aging
The Maryland Association of Non-Profit Homes for the Aged (MANPHA)
The Council of Jewish Federations, the Health Facilities Association of Maryland (HFAM)
The American Health Care Association (AHCA)
The Association of Jewish Aging Services (AJAS)
